The Professional Choice for Reliable Brake Lines
If you're replacing corroded brake lines, choosing the right material is the difference between doing the job once or doing it again in a few years. While standard copper pipe is easy to bend, it lacks the structural strength required for long-term peace of mind. That’s where Copper Nickel (Kunifer) comes in.
Commonly referred to as CuNi, NiCopp, or cupro-nickel, this alloy is the industry standard for high-quality brake line fabrication. Unlike standard copper, which can work-harden and crack under constant chassis vibration, Copper Nickel offers superior fatigue strength. It is highly resistant to the harsh road salt and moisture that destroys steel lines, making it the ideal choice for under-body routing on vehicles facing UK winter roads.
In the Workshop
In the workshop, Kunifer strikes the perfect balance between workability and durability. It is slightly stiffer than pure copper, meaning it holds its shape beautifully once bent, giving you those neat, professional factory-look runs. However, it remains malleable enough to be formed by hand or with a pipe bender, and it flares cleanly without splitting when using a decent flaring tool.
Why Choose Copper Nickel (Kunifer)?
Superior Corrosion Resistance: Impervious to road salt, moisture, and brake fluid degradation.
High Fatigue Strength: Resists work-hardening and cracking caused by vehicle vibration.
Professional Finish: Harder than pure copper, allowing for neater bends and crisper, more secure flares.
Higher Pressure Rating: Easily handles the extreme hydraulic pressures of modern braking and ABS systems.
